Embedded Software Engineer

Remote Full-time
Wanco Inc. is seeking an experienced Embedded Software Engineer in the Arvada, CO production facility.

Summary:

The Embedded Software team develops firmware to support our products’ control systems, instrumentation, and interfaces. This is a transformational time to join the team, to help drive the modernization of our tooling, developmental practices, and coding standards. The team recently renewed the vision to create a unified platform that will replace various outdated and legacy systems.

The professional we seek will be a key member of a well-established, successful small company that continues to grow through quality products, increasing global demand for industrial technology, and valued employees.

Responsibilities:

· Develop firmware on bare metal and embedded Linux systems.

· Write clean, well-tested, and organized code, with a commitment to quality.

· Drive the adoption of unit tests and good development standards.

· Work with the Linux kernel and applications in embedded environments.

· Maintain legacy software and devices.

· Engineer software systems integrated with SPI, I2C, UART, and USB bus interfaces.

· Design and implement GUIs for embedded displays.

· Debug software on hardware devices.

· Analyze electrical and electronics schematic diagrams.

Requirements or Qualifications

· Strong experience in C development for embedded systems.

· Excellent verbal and written communication skills

· The critical thinking to evaluate decisions despite lack of information.

· BSEE, BSCE, BSCS, or equivalent combination of education and work experience

· 15+ years of professional experience in software development in a commercial environment.

Desirable:

· Experience building embedded Linux systems using tools like Buildroot.

· Experience with lean manufacturing and ISO 9001

Reporting: This position reports to the Director of Engineering.

Benefits: Insurance (Medical, Dental, Life, 401k). Paid time off and holidays.

Eligible to participate in Wanco’s standard benefits package.

Job Type: Full-time

Pay: $120,000.00 - $150,000.00 per year

Benefits:
• 401(k)
• Dental insurance
• Health insurance
• Paid time off
• Vision insurance

Schedule:
• 10 hour shift
• 8 hour shift
• Day shift
• Monday to Friday
• Overtime
• Weekends as needed

Work Location: In person

Apply Now

Apply Now →

Similar Jobs

Experienced Registered Behavior Technician for In-Home ABA Therapy - Atlanta, GA

Remote

Immediate Hiring: Experienced Registered Behavioral Technician (RBT) for Clinic-Based ABA Therapy Services

Remote

Experienced Registered Behavioral Technician (RBT) - ABA Therapy for Children with Autism Spectrum Disorder

Remote

Experienced Registered Nurse - Telehealth: Providing Remote Care Coordination and Patient Support

Remote

Experienced Substitute Teacher for Riverside County Schools - Join Scoot Education's Innovative Team

Remote

Experienced Substitute Teacher for San Bernardino County - Flexible Schedules & Competitive Pay

Remote

Experienced School Year Instructional Coach for High-Dosage Tutoring Programs in Edgewater Park, NJ

Remote

Experienced School Year Tutor for K-8 Students in Math and Literacy - Mickleton, NJ

Remote

Experienced Secondary Social Studies Teacher for Kansas - Flexible Hybrid Remote Arrangement

Remote

USPS Office Helper

Remote

Entry Level Subsea Design Engineer

Remote

User Health Strategist

Remote

**Experienced Remote Data Entry Operator – Flexible Part-Time Opportunity with arenaflex**

Remote

[Remote-Position] Microsoft Dynamics 365 Developer

Remote

Senior Actuarial Analyst (REMOTE ROLE)

Remote

**Experienced Planning & Operations Analytics Intern - Marvel Comics Data Entry & Insights Specialist (Remote Work, Entry Level)**

Remote

Market Trainer

Remote

Nurse Auditor 2 (WORK AT HOME | ANYWHERE IN THE US/PUERTO RICO)

Remote

Kelly Services Remote Spanish Interpreters in Texas in Plano, Texas

Remote

Project Manager, Intelligent PMO Systems

Remote
← Back